Definition

What is Industrial Emission Control?

Every factory produces some form of airborne pollution, whether it is dust, fumes, vapors, or gases. Industrial emission control is all about catching those pollutants before they escape into the air. It is a core part of air pollution control and helps manufacturers stay compliant with environmental regulations while keeping workers safe.

In practice, this means using technologies like dust collection systems, industrial air filtration, and other industrial air cleaning methods to capture particles, VOCs, and harmful gases right at the source. These emission control solutions are tailored to the specific process, because no two factories have the same challenges. Some of the most common solutions:

Wet scrubbers: Venturi, packed‑bed, spray columns and chemical scrubbers for gases, sticky aerosols and when heat recovery is desired

Dust Collection Systems: Baghouse, envelope, cartridge filters, pulse jet filter for dust separation and high‑efficiency particulate removal

Dust Cyclones: Cyclones and gravity/settling pre‑separators to lower dust load before filters or scrubbers

Heat recovery equipment: shell‑and‑tube exchangers, Energy Recovery scrubbers, and heat pumps to upgrade recovered heat (water/steam)

Odor Abatement Control Systems: Activated carbon, canisters, beds and catalytic/thermal options for VOC/odor control

Electrostatic precipitators: for very fine or sub‑micron particulate removal

Cold plasma: advanced oxidation modules as low‑temperature VOC/odor polishing steps

Selection depends on composition, temperature, humidity and particle type. Wet scrubbers handle gases and sticky loads, dry filters suit dry dust, ESP/WESP capture fine particles, carbon treats VOCs, plasma fits low concentrations, and RTO handles high VOC loads. Often a staged combination is optimal.
